 Our range of stone products,are hand-crafted by our team of highly
skilled masons, from many different types of stone. The stones that we use are all quarried in the British Isles and many of them are of the type used in the restoration of our historic buildings.
For example, Catcastle Sandstone is used to produce a number of our candleholders and most of our historically important buildings in the Stirling area are restored using this, among other types, of
stone.
These buildings include Stirling Castle, The Wallace Monument, the Old Town
Jail and the Church of the Holy Rude - Impressions in Stone has been involved in the restoration works of all these buildings at some stage or another.
